I cant say enough good things about Vicky. My husband and I had a terrible hospital experience, we were denied a lactation specialist, given terrible advice, and our baby was maimed by a careless nurse in the hospital that culminated with us leaving the hospital a day early and our new daughter needing 3 stitches. Our Doula suggested that we call Vicky to assist us with post partum care. When I called her at my wits end, I was in tears. Unable to nurse, feeling completely useless, I had no idea how I was going to take care of my new baby. Vicky arrived at our house within the hour. Yes, she does housecalls!
Vicky listened intently to our story of our experience at the hospital, showed immense empathy, and immediately set about to gently and kindly offer us the tools to nurture our new daughter. We went from suffering scabby nipples and no milk to feeding formula in a bottle to using SNS tubing to using a nipple shield to finally latching and nursing with just mommy and baby. Vicky gave gentle, sensible advice. She never preached or scolded, just gently reassuring us that with consistency, education, and patience, we would have a great nursing experience. I dont know what I would have done without Vicky. I truly believe that without her, my baby would be drinking formula from a bottle. I literally cried through every attempted feeding before Vicky came to the rescue, feeling like I was scarring my child for life, now I look forward to nursing time to bond with our little girl. I now know that this experience is not insurmountable and it is well worth the hard work. I would have given up without Vicky. I and my daughter owe her the greatest thanks for gently encouraging the bond that is growing between us. When I'm nursing now and my baby looks up at me and spits out my nipple and smiles mischeviously and I relatch her and smile back, I cant help but to think a little silent thank you to Vicky. I would very highly reccomend that anyone having a baby make sure to hire a post partum Doula, especially Vicky York. She's absolutely a lifesaver.
